Walk-in shower conversion costs in the UK
Replace a bath with an accessible shower area, allowing for drainage, screens, waterproofing and making good.

These figures are early UK planning allowances. They are not a substitute for an itemised quotation after inspection.
Control the variables
What can change the quote?
Pipe and soil-stack alterations
Tiling area and tile format
Waterproofing and subfloor condition
Sanitaryware and brassware specification
Before accepting a quote
Ask for these details in writing
- ✓Labour, materials and VAT
- ✓Preparation and protection
- ✓Access equipment and waste
- ✓Named provisional allowances
- ✓Testing and certification
- ✓Programme and payment stages
- ✓Making good and decoration
- ✓Warranty and snagging process
